How to Freeze Blueberry Chocolate Chip Pancakes. Allow the pancakes to cool to room temperature before freezing. Place a sheet of parchment paper between each pancake to prevent sticking. Wrap the stack of pancakes tightly in plastic wrap or aluminum foil. Place the wrapped pancakes in a freezer bag, removing as much air as possible.
